Top 5 iOS Horror Games in Kenya Q3 2024
Explore the performance metrics of the top 5 horror games on iOS in Kenya during Q3 2024, highlighting trends in downloads and revenue.
In the third quarter of 2024, the top horror games on the iOS platform in Kenya revealed a variety of trends in downloads and revenue, according to Sensor Tower's data.
Mystery Matters, published by Playrix, showed a fluctuating revenue pattern with a notable peak of approximately $14 in the week of September 16. The game also had a few instances of downloads, reaching 2 in the weeks of August 12 and August 26.
Resident Evil 4 by CAPCOM had a significant spike in revenue, reaching about $41 in the week of September 9, while downloads remained low with a maximum of 4 in the week of September 2.
OXENFREE II: Lost Signals from Netflix, Inc. experienced scattered revenue peaks, with $12 in the week of July 8 and August 12, and $8 in the week of September 9. However, no downloads were recorded throughout the quarter.
Poppy Playtime Chapter 1 by Mob Entertainment, Inc. maintained a modest revenue flow, peaking at $8 in the weeks of July 1 and July 29, with no downloads reported during the quarter.
Lastly, Five Nights at Freddy's 3 from CLICKTEAM LLC USA had a revenue high of $10 in the week of August 5. Downloads were minimal, with a peak of 6 in the week of September 23.
